Is Apache Spark-2.2.1 compatible with Hadoop-3.0.0

hello Users,
I need to know whether we can run latest spark on  latest hadoop version
i.e., spark-2.2.1 released on 1st dec and hadoop-3.0.0 released on 13th dec.

And Hadoop-3.x is not part of the release and sign off for 2.2.1.

Maybe we could update the website to avoid any confusion with "later".

My current best guess is that Spark does not fully support Hadoop 3.x because https://issues.apache.org/jira/browse/SPARK-18673 (updates to Hive shims for Hadoop 3.x) has not been resolved. There are also likely to be transitive dependency conflicts which will need to be resolved.

AFAIK, there's no large scale test for Hadoop 3.0 in the community. So it is not clear whether it is supported or not (or has some issues). I think in the download page "Pre-Built for Apache Hadoop 2.7 and later" mostly means that it supports Hadoop 2.7+ (2.8...), but not 3.0 (IIUC).
